What is Female Pattern Hair Loss?
Female pattern hair loss, also known as androgenetic alopecia, is a progressive condition where women experience thinning hair primarily on the top and crown of the scalp. Unlike male pattern baldness, FPHL rarely results in complete baldness but can cause significant thinning that impacts overall hair volume and density.
Typically, FPHL begins with a widening of the parting, followed by diffuse thinning across the crown. This condition often becomes more noticeable after menopause, although it can occur at any age.
What Causes Female Pattern Hair Loss?
Female pattern hair loss is primarily influenced by genetics and hormonal changes. Here's a breakdown of the main triggers:
Genetic Predisposition
If your family has a history of hair thinning, you are more likely to develop female pattern hair loss. Inherited sensitivity to androgens (male hormones present in both men and women) can shrink hair follicles, resulting in thinner hair over time.
Hormonal Changes
Hormones play a crucial role in hair growth. Menopause, pregnancy, or conditions such as pol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S) can alter hormone levels, leading to hair loss.
Ageing
As we age, hair follicles naturally produce thinner, shorter hairs. This process can be accelerated by female pattern hair loss, further reducing hair density.
Stress and Lifestyle Factors
High stress levels, nutritional deficiencies, and certain medical conditions may exacerbate the condition, though they are not direct causes.
Dealing with Female Pattern Hair Loss
Though female pattern hair loss can't always be completely cured, there are ways to manage, treat, and even reverse its effects in some cases. Here are some strategies:
Seek a Professional Diagnosis
If you notice thinning hair or a widening parting, consult a specialist. An accurate diagnosis is essential to rule out other conditions such as alopecia areata or telogen effluvium.
Consider Medical Treatments
- Topical Treatments: Minoxidil is a widely recognised option for promoting hair growth. It's applied directly to the scalp and can help slow down hair loss while encouraging regrowth.
- Hormone Therapy: For women experiencing hormonal imbalances, hormone therapy may help regulate the androgens contributing to hair thinning.
Adopt a Healthy Lifestyle
A balanced diet rich in vitamins and minerals, particularly biotin, zinc, and iron, supports hair health. Additionally, managing stress through mindfulness or exercise can benefit hair growth.
Explore Advanced Hair Loss Solutions
Treatments like low-level laser therapy (LLLT) or platelet-rich plasma (PRP) therapy can stimulate hair growth and improve scalp health. Discuss these options with a specialist to determine what's right for you.
